A building materials calculator is required that can be dropped straight into a web page and, from one user input—the total area in m²—instantly returns how many panels of mineral wool cladding are needed, as well as accesories for the system (screws, washers, mesh etc) Core flow • Single input field labelled “Total area (m²)”. • Behind the scenes the script multiplies this value by the coverage figure I will supply for each panel & accessories (and rounds up to whole units). • Result is displayed immediately on the same page without refresh. Build it in clean, self-contained HTML / CSS / JavaScript so I can paste the snippet into an existing site (WordPress block or any static page). No external paid libraries; vanilla JS or a lightweight framework is fine as long as the final folder is under 100 KB and works in all modern browsers, desktop and mobile. Deliverables 1. Excel sheet with formulas used to create calculator for webpage 2. Commented source files (HTML, CSS, JS) ready to embed. 3. A brief README showing where to drop in the board-coverage value and how to change any labels or colours. 4. Live demo link or video capture proving the calculator works exactly as specified. I will handle styling tweaks and hosting once the files arrive; just keep the code clear and easy to extend for future inputs such as waste allowance or different board sizes.
